How were jobs different for african americans in the 1950s?
Ksivusya [100]
Blacks were concentrated in the lowest-paying, dirtiest, and most hazardous jobs, and were routinely harassed and assaulted. It was not enough to have separate bathrooms for blacks and whites; the "black" bathrooms were often located far from specific workplaces, forcing employees to spend a good deal of their break getting there and coming back. It was not enough to have separate water fountains for blacks and whites; the "black" fountains were never cleaned, and the water was always warm.

What did archaeologists find in the Cave at Diuktai?A.Clovis points similar to those found in New MexicoB.stone tools similar to
Elena-2011 [213]

Answer:

B?

Explanation:

Most stone artifacts at Dyuktai Cave are waste from tool production, consisting of wedge-Shaped cores And a few single-platform and radially flaked cores. other stone tools included bifaces, shaped burins, scrapers, knives and scrapers made on blades and flakes.
